Grubbing services involve the removal of unwanted vegetation, roots, stumps, and other underground obstructions from a property. These services typically include the use of specialized equipment to excavate and clear areas, making way for construction, landscaping, or drainage projects. The goal is to prepare the land by eliminating obstacles that could interfere with future development or maintenance efforts. Professionals offering grubbing services have the expertise to handle various soil conditions and ensure that the site is thoroughly cleared according to project requirements.

One of the primary issues grubbing services address is the challenge of dealing with persistent roots and stumps that can hinder landscaping or construction activities. Unremoved roots can cause uneven ground, damage to machinery, or complications during foundation work. Additionally, overgrown vegetation and buried debris can pose safety hazards or impede proper drainage. By removing these obstacles, property owners can reduce the risk of future issues, such as soil instability or pest infestations, and facilitate smoother progress for subsequent projects.

The overview below groups typical Grubbing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Davis County, UT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Acre Cost - Grubbing services typically range from $500 to $2,500 per acre, depending on the density of vegetation and soil conditions. For example, clearing an acre of overgrown land might cost around $1,200.

Per Square Foot Cost - For smaller projects, costs can range from $0.10 to $0.50 per square foot. Clearing a 1,000-square-foot area could therefore cost between $100 and $500.

Hourly Rates - Some contractors charge hourly, with rates generally between $50 and $150 per hour. The total depends on the project's complexity and the number of workers involved.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for stump removal, debris hauling, or difficult terrain, often adding several hundred dollars to the overall cost. These fees vary based on project specifics and site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
